How Much Does Window Installation Cost In Van Wert?

Window installation and replacement costs vary based on several factors, including how difficult your windows are to access or install, the number and size of the windows, and the materials you choose. On average, homeowners in Van Wert will spend around $280 per window*. When To Replace Windows

New, energy-efficient windows can substantially improve your home's noise reduction, appearance, comfort, insulation, and value. Clear indicators that it's time for window replacement include the following:

  • High energy bills and discomfort from poor window insulation.
  • Windows that are difficult to close, open, and lock properly due to wear and age.
  • Cold air and drafts leaking in from old, loose-fitting windows.
  • Inefficient and outdated window styles that take away from your house's curb appeal.
  • Fogging between window panes, condensation issues, or rotting window frames allowing moisture intrusion into the home.

How To Choose a Window Company

For a successful window replacement, you want to hire an installation contractor with proven expertise. Below, we cover the most important qualifications for picking a window installer.

Experience

Look for highly-regarded local companies with many years, ideally decades, of experience successfully installing all kinds of windows. These providers are more likely to have a deep knowledge of Van Wert's climate and local homeowner needs. Request references from recent clients to confirm the quality of a company's work.

Certifications

Choose companies that have certifications from leading window brands, and that have Fenestration and Glazing Industry Alliance (formerly AAMA) certification. Being certified indicates that they've received proper training in installation best practices. Make sure installers are staff, not subcontractors, and confirm the technicians doing your job are certified.

Reputation

Spend time going through online reviews, checking the Better Business Bureau, and asking for references from people in your area. Review customer feedback to verify that a company delivers consistent quality workmanship and great service. Avoid companies with complaints of shoddy work or unfinished jobs.

Process

A good window installer will be able to provide a complete project plan, precise timelines, clear expectations, and an overview of all material and installation options. Avoid companies that provide unclear quotes or schedules. Look for regular contact from the beginning to avoid surprises once installation is underway.

Warranties

Seek out window installers that guarantee their work and provide warranties on labor and materials. This shows confidence in their work. Choose companies with unlimited lifetime warranties that can transfer to new homeowners.

Materials

Ensure your provider installs durable, energy-efficient window brands that fit your budget. Look for design flexibility, good energy ratings, and enhanced UV protection. Confirm the window materials have their own manufacturer warranties as well.

In Van Wert, the best time to install windows is when temperatures are mild, generally in the spring or fall. These conditions enable installers to do their work without having to worry about the weather.

The right type of replacement windows for your Van Wert home depends on when your home was built –the average house in Van Wert was built around 1958. If your home was built a while ago, you might want to consider efficient windows such as double-pane windows, which are designed to keep your home cool in the summer and warm in the winter. Wood frames also have a classic look that's perfect for older homes. For newer homes, you can think about vinyl windows, which are durable, affordable and have a modern look.

You can save money on window installation by choosing a less expensive option like single-hung vinyl windows. These come at a lower cost compared to more expensive windows like double-hung, fiberglass, or wood windows.

The process for window installation typically includes taking measurements, removing the old windows, installing the new windows, checking for proper sealing, and applying caulk around the edges of the frames. Extra steps may be necessary depending on the style of window being installed.

Yes, many window companies provide financing options. Some installers offer low-interest loans based on your income, while other companies provide special financing plans with agreements and conditions that vary depending on the project.

Window companies in Van Wert usually offer a wide range of services, including measuring and installing new windows, repairing existing windows, swapping out window glass, and hanging window treatments. They may also offer extra services such as weatherproofing or cleaning.
